Transaction 66926717666f06d081794cf94d901213ede6868c30aacb867b791fd741b7dd77
1 Input
1 Output
-
66926717666f06d081794cf94d901213ede6868c30aacb867b791fd741b7dd77:0
- value
- 3287
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 3717663356ce07762158177f220beaea3d939e16 OP_EQUALVERIFY OP_CHECKSIG
- address
- 162JCMi66dTT2DTvJcuC75mGYaX2ZXkezx